Heads up — we're seeing cron drift on the Pelgrave batch boxes again. Jobs scheduled for 02:00 are firing anywhere from 02:07 to 02:19, which throws off the Fennick report customers see each morning. The clocksync team is investigating; likely an NTP config regression from last week's base image update. If customers ask, say a fix is in progress. For status updates, write to the investigation lead.

escalation mailbox, bafog-fafog: ulador@paliqlabs.internal

For the weekly sync: the Brightquill barcode scanner integration reads its device-polling interval and vendor endpoint from environment variables, documented in the service README. Misconfigured intervals cause duplicate scan events, so double-check staging values before promoting. The final variable in the env file authenticates against the vendor bridge, and it belongs on the line immediately following this sentence.

vault entry, kafog-yahop: COURIER_KEY8=0faa53ae

TICKET PF-2291 — Checkout load test regression. Summary for weekly sync: Quickcart checkout p95 latency jumped from 340ms to 1.9s at 400 VUs. Payment stub fine; bottleneck is the tax-calc sidecar, which serializes requests under load. Repro: run the Harkness load profile against staging, 10 min ramp. Mitigation candidate: raise sidecar worker pool to 8. Not release-blocking yet, but flagging before Thursday cut. Owner: Priya on the Velton squad. Trace for the worst request is below.

pipeline stamp: htk3_cc5

Hi Dorit,

Handing over the Fernvale Clinic reminder job. It runs nightly at 02:15, pulls tomorrow's appointments, and queues SMS batches. Watch for stuck rows in `reminder_outbox`—requeue them manually if the status stays pending past 03:00. The job authenticates to the scheduling database with the connection string below.

primary connection of kahof-kagep = mssql://belath_svc:3uqY4g6LHG5Nyi@db-d0ba.ferralabs.corp:5432/rusdor